Bharmani Khad
Bharmani Khad is a stream in Himachal Pradesh, India and has an elevation of 2,189 metres. Bharmani Khad is situated nearby to the locality Sachon, as well as near Philanda Ani Got.Places in the Area

Bharmour is a village in the Indian state of Himachal Pradesh. Located in Chamba district, it is known for the Chaurasi Temple complex. Bharmour is associated with the historical Brahampura, the capital of Chamba State.
